Liverpool manager Arne Slot has strongly defended Mohamed Salah against fan criticism following Liverpool’s 2-1 defeat to Chelsea. Slot stated that Salah has not lost his form, emphasizing that there are various playing circumstances, and highlighting that Salah is an important player crucial to the team and relied upon for the club’s ambitions.
Slot also addressed Salah’s chances in the Chelsea match, acknowledging that Salah missed opportunities that could have resulted in goals, but he defended him by pointing out that the game was tough, both teams were evenly matched, and victory went to the side that showed finishing ability in the final minutes.
Liverpool fans specifically blamed Salah for failing to score, especially missing a key chance, but the manager praised Salah’s effort and overall level within the team.
He added that even top players sometimes miss opportunities, but that does not diminish their overall contribution.
